Shropshire autism needs assessment

Proposal

Shropshire Children's Trust are undertaking an informal consultation around the 0-25 Children and Young People's Autism Needs Assessment and we would like your feedback on the document.

The Needs Assessment was created in partnership with parents and carers, schools and providers of services for children and young people with autism. It includes information around prevalence of autism, level of need and availability of services, as well as other information and feedback from stakeholders.

The document is attached to this page and we're asking any interested party to take the time to read it and let us know your thoughts.
